To simplify \( 13^{12} \div 13^{-10} \), you can use the properties of exponents to combine the terms.
When you divide two terms with the same base, you subtract their exponents as per the quotient rule \( a^m \div a^n = a^{m-n} \):
\( 13^{12} \div 13^{-10} = 13^{(12 - (-10))} \)
Now let's do the subtraction:
\( 13^{12 - (-10)} = 13^{12 + 10} \)
\( 13^{22} \)
So, the simplified version of \( 13^{12} \div 13^{-10} \) is \( 13^{22} \).
